5.10.2
Confirming the bridge relay
The contents of confirmation when a bridge relay is used in the router are as
described below.
5.10.2.1
Confirmation of bridge interface state
Execute a show bridge interface command and confirm that an interface is in the
forwarding state (state participating in a frame relay).
Figure 5-95 Display of bridge interface state
5.10.2.2
Confirmation of filtering database
Execute a show bridge fdb command and confirm that the static entry of a filtering
database is correct.
